Richard Anthony "Dick" McGlynn (born July 19, 1948 in Medford, Massachusetts) is a retired professional ice hockey player who played 30 regular season games in the World Hockey Association for the Chicago Cougars in 1972–73. As an amateur, he played for the Colgate University men's hockey team as well as the United States national team at the 1972 Winter Olympics and also the 1971 and 1972 Ice Hockey World Championship tournaments.
